Avantages et inconvénients
par nos spécialistes
Le Samsung Galaxy S24 5G 256GB Amber Yellow se distingue par sa grande autonomie, son écran lumineux et ses performances rapides. Son design compact et léger est agréable à utiliser d’une main, et la promesse de sept ans de mises à jour est rassurante. Cependant, l’appareil photo n’est pas toujours fiable, surtout en basse lumière, et le logiciel Samsung est souvent complexe. L’appareil est moins résistant aux rayures que la version Ultra et la charge est relativement lente. C’est un excellent choix pour ceux qui cherchent un Android compact et puissant, mais les amateurs de photo et de logiciel doivent tenir compte de ces défauts.
